Biography

Megafaun, an American psychedelic folk band based in Durham, North Carolina, formed in 2006. Brothers Brad Cook and Phil Cook, along with Joe Westerlund, first met at the H.O.R.D.E. festival in 1997 and later played together in DeYarmond Edison with Justin Vernon. After DeYarmond Edison broke up in 2006, they formed Megafaun. Their debut release, Bury the Square (2008), was followed by their second album, Gather, Form & Fly (2009), on the Hometapes label. They released two more albums: Heretofore (2010) and Megafaun (2011). They toured with notable acts such as The Mountain Goats, Bowerbirds, Akron/Family, and The Drive-By Truckers. In October 2012, they announced an indefinite hiatus.
